Cosmetology Manager Course

The purpose of the managers course is to give the student the knowledge and competency in the area of Salon Management and ownership.

Admission Requirements:

Student must be evaluated by the staff and pass an evaluation with a score of at least 50 points.

Hours Required:
300 hours
Length (Day Classes):
Approx. 3 months
Length (Night Classes):
N/A
Cosmetology Laws & Rules
Ohio Cosmetology Statues and Rules. Inspections & Enforcement, Ohio Revised Code Statues, Ohio Administrative Rules, License & Permit Policy, Continuning Education Policy / Procedure, Inspections & Enforcement Policy/Procedure. 40
Public Health & Safety
Sanitation Practice/Procedure. Sanitation Practice/Procedure. Dispensary Operations/Procedure. Bacteria, Contagious & Communicable Disease Control. Salon Operations & Procedures. Consumer & Product Safety. 35
Advanced Techniques
Advanced hair analysis, Hair shaping, thermal techniques, blow drying, wave techniques, straightening techniques, advanced color and corrective color. 225
Total Hours: 300

State Requirements (License)

The State Exam consists of a written exam only.

  1. A 10th grade or equivalent
  2. 300 clock hour in a licensed school
  3. A written exam of 60 questions, passed with a 75%

Applicant Must Provide:

  1. An education statement, or diploma
  2. One picture (2½ X 3½)
  3. If send with the Cosmetology application the fee is included.

Managers Graduation Requirements to Receive Diploma

The following are after completion of Basic Cosmetology Requirements.

  1. completed class portion with an 80 or better
  2. completed manager project
  3. all tuition or obligations paid in full, or arrangements have been made.
